Vakiojännite LED driver is a power supply that provides a steady voltage output, ensuring that connected LED fixtures receive a consistent voltage, typically 12V or 24V. This type of driver is designed to operate with LED lights that are made to function at a specified voltage, making it essential for various applications, including LED strips, signage, and architectural lighting.
The Principle of Constant Voltage Driving
Constant voltage drivers work on a straightforward principle. They maintain a specific voltage output regardless of fluctuations in input voltage or changes in load current. This regulation ensures that the connected LEDs operate efficiently and are less likely to experience thermal and electrical stress, which can lead to shorter lifespans or failure.

How to Choose a Model for Your Constant Voltage LED Driver
When selecting a constant voltage LED driver, consider the following criteria:
Make sure to choose a driver that matches the required voltage of your LED lights. Common voltages include 12V and 24V.
Assess the total wattage required by your LED fixtures. Choose a driver that can provide at least 20% more power than your system’s total requirement to ensure efficiency and reliability.
A high-efficiency driver will help reduce energy consumption and heat output. Look for drivers with efficiency ratings above 85%.
Check if the driver has adequate thermal management features, such as heat sinks or ventilation, as overheating can reduce performance and lifespan.
Select drivers with built-in safety features like overcurrent, overvoltage, and short-circuit protection to enhance the overall safety of your lighting system.

Why Use Constant Voltage for LED Light Strips?
LED light strips are typically designed to run on a specific voltage, making constant voltage drivers the appropriate choice. Using a constant voltage driver ensures that these strips are powered efficiently without risking overvoltage, which can lead to overheating and decreased lifespan.
